    I can now understand better what I was supposed to ask about Internet explorer 5.5. First of all they are using windows 2000. Internet explorer 5.5 and when the search button at top of page is hit the www.abc.com search 54 page comes up and this just happened a couple of months ago. What I need to know is how do I get rid of this search page and set the internet explorer back to normal. I cannot find out where internet explorer repair is on the windows 2000 or even if their is one. I do not know even if this will work if their is an internet explorer repair tool kit. But their must be someway I can change it back. Do hope someone has the answer for me.

    I think TOOLS > INTERNET OPTIONS > PROGRAMS > RESET WEB SETTINGS should do what you are needing.
